Texas Wide Open for Business Website<br />

www.TexasWideOpenForBusiness.com<br />

In FY <strong>2011</strong>, the marketing team continued to<br />

upgrade the content on the Texas Wide Open<br />

for Business website. Upgrades make the site<br />

more intuitive for site selectors, companies, and<br />

communities seeking business data. The website<br />

provides information and links needed for anyone<br />

considering doing business in Texas. The site<br />

includes state incentives, Texas achievements,<br />

new company location announcements, marketing<br />

resources for Texas community economic<br />

developers, and an interactive map that allows<br />

users to explore various infrastructure resources<br />

to narrow site searches.<br />

On January 1, 2012, the Texas Wide Open for<br />

Business website will launch a major redesign<br />

to help address needs that have been identified<br />

through feedback from companies and consultants<br />

throughout the year.<br />

Texas Site Search<br />

www.texassitesearch.com<br />

The Texas Site Search website is an innovative<br />

online state-level GIS mapping program designed<br />

to aid companies and consultants researching<br />

Texas as a possible expansion or relocation site.<br />

The site is a free service to Texas communities<br />

looking to gain more exposure through property<br />

listings and is an additional online portal for<br />

communities already hosting localized GIS-based<br />

services.<br />

Website tools include detailed available property<br />

listings, custom downloadable reports, links to<br />

local economic development sites, state incentive<br />

programs, and industry maps.<br />

The <strong>TexasOne</strong>℠ Twitter and Texas Wide Open for Business Facebook pages allow followers to<br />

gather up-to-date information on the Texas economy. In FY 2012, the marketing team will continue<br />

to distribute news items to constituents through online social networks. Updates include Texas<br />

brags, job creation announcements, and TEF and ETF award announcements.<br />
